Nalani Duba - Thelamara, Sonitpur

Nalani Duba is a village situated in the Thelamara subdivision of Sonitpur district, Assam. It is located approximately 160 km from Dhekiajuli and around 34 km from Tezpur. Thelamara serves as the Gram Panchayat for Nalani Duba village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Nalani Duba is 285721. The village covers a total geographical area of 93.23 hectares and falls under the 784149 pincode. Dhekiajuli is the nearest town, located about 14 km away.

Nalani Duba village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Tezp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Sonitp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Nalani Duba

As per Census 2011, Nalani Duba village has a total population of 325 people, consisting of 155 males and 170 females. The village has 59 households and a sex ratio of 1,096 females per 1,000 males. There are 39 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 207 literate and 118 illiterate residents. Additionally, 318 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Nalani Duba

Public transport in the Nalani Duba is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Nalani Duba.

ConnectivityStatusNearest Availability
Public Bus ServiceNoAvailable within 5-10 km
Private Bus ServiceYesAvailable within village
Railway StationNoAvailable within >10 km

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Dhekiajuli to Nalani Duba is about 14 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Tezpur to Nalani Duba is about 34 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.

Health Facilities in Nalani Duba

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Nalani Duba village are given below:

Facility TypeStatusNearest Availability
Health Sub-Centre (HSC)YesAvailable within village
Primary Health Centre (PHC)NoAvailable within 2-5 km
Community Health Centre (CHC)NoAvailable within >10 km
